Output 2b7b8aae3431616632c952ee6b1ee14985ccfe146b93bcba50a652000f710818:18

value
2476493
script pubkey
OP_0 OP_PUSHBYTES_20 8bda7738705873bf24536327311a11e2fdbae96d
address
bc1q30d8wwrstpem7fznvvnnzxs3ut7m46tdhe4rzs
transaction
2b7b8aae3431616632c952ee6b1ee14985ccfe146b93bcba50a652000f710818
confirmations
243191
spent
true